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kilmarnock to Strathcarron start from as little as £40.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ities at Kilmarnock Station

Kilmarnock station caters to a diverse array of passenger needs with its extensive facilities. The ticket office operates throughout the week with generous opening hours, from early morning till late evening on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ly reduced hours on Sundays. Travellers can easily collect tickets bought online at the machine available at the station. Moreover, it's reassuring to know that there are accessible ticket machines for those requiring them.

Accessibility is a key focus at Kilmarnock station. It boasts step-free access throughout, with the added convenience of lifts connecting the underpass to Platform 4. While ticket barriers are absent, there are ample facilities including induction loops for the hearing impaired and designated seating areas equipped with wheelchairs. However, take note that though there are no baby changing facilities, there is a waiting room with a seating area.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Strathcarron Station, despite its charm, keeps things simple. It lacks a ticket office and any ticket machines, so purchasing your tickets online in advance is a necessity. While you won't find automated services for ticketing, support is available through help points, and the station offers an induction loop for those in need of auditory assistance. There's no need to worry about barriers as Strathcarron has no ticket barriers or gates, offering a seamless transit experience.

In terms of accessibility, the station features some step-free access with a footbridge equipped with stairs connecting the platforms. There are also two Blue Badge parking bays in a car park that's freely accessible and monitored by CCTV, providing reassurance for travelers leaving their vehicles behind.
